This volume brings together three significant works by Francis Bacon: The Essays, Colours of Good and Evil, and Advancement of Learning. Bacon's Essays, a collection of concise reflections on various aspects of human life and society, offer timeless wisdom on topics ranging from ambition and adversity to love and friendship. Written in a clear and aphoristic style, these essays provide invaluable insights into the complexities of human nature and the art of living well.
Colours of Good and Evil delves into the nuances of moral judgment, exploring the subtle distinctions between right and wrong. Bacon examines how appearances can be deceptive and how careful reasoning is essential for discerning true virtue from mere semblance.
Advancement of Learning is a groundbreaking treatise on the state of knowledge and the importance of empirical inquiry. Bacon argues for a systematic approach to scientific investigation, laying the foundation for the modern scientific method and advocating for the pursuit of knowledge for the betterment of humanity. Together, these works showcase Bacon's profound intellect and enduring relevance as a philosopher, statesman, and literary stylist.
